svn commit: r494003 - head/devel/packr

Koichiro Iwao meta at FreeBSD.org
Wed Feb 27 00:42:48 UTC 2019


Author: meta
Date: Wed Feb 27 00:42:47 2019
New Revision: 494003
URL: https://svnweb.freebsd.org/changeset/ports/494003

Log:
  devel/packr: Update to 2.0.2
  
  - Switch to default build/install targets provided by go.mk
  - Install both v1 (packr) and v2 (packr2) binaries
  
  PR:		236053
  Submitted by:	Dmitri Goutnik <dg at syrec.org> (maintainer)
  Relnotes:	https://github.com/gobuffalo/packr/releases/tag/v2.0.2

Modified:
  head/devel/packr/Makefile
  head/devel/packr/distinfo

Modified: head/devel/packr/Makefile
==============================================================================
--- head/devel/packr/Makefile	Tue Feb 26 23:51:17 2019	(r494002)
+++ head/devel/packr/Makefile	Wed Feb 27 00:42:47 2019	(r494003)
@@ -2,7 +2,7 @@
 
 PORTNAME=	packr
 DISTVERSIONPREFIX=	v
-DISTVERSION=	2.0.1
+DISTVERSION=	2.0.2
 CATEGORIES=	devel
 
 MAINTAINER=	dg at syrec.org
@@ -13,47 +13,47 @@ LICENSE_FILE=	${WRKSRC}/LICENSE.txt
 
 USES=		go
 
+GO_PKGNAME=	github.com/gobuffalo/packr
+GO_TARGET=	./packr \
+		./v2/packr2
+
 USE_GITHUB=	yes
 GH_ACCOUNT=	gobuffalo
-GH_SUBDIR=	src/github.com/gobuffalo/packr
 GH_TUPLE=	\
-		BurntSushi:toml:v0.3.1:toml/src/github.com/BurntSushi/toml \
-		gobuffalo:buffalo-plugins:v1.11.0:buffalo_plugins/src/github.com/gobuffalo/buffalo-plugins \
-		gobuffalo:envy:v1.6.12:envy/src/github.com/gobuffalo/envy \
-		gobuffalo:events:v1.1.9:events/src/github.com/gobuffalo/events \
-		gobuffalo:flect:a62e61d:flect/src/github.com/gobuffalo/flect \
-		gobuffalo:genny:f31a84f:genny/src/github.com/gobuffalo/genny \
-		gobuffalo:logger:5b956e2:logger/src/github.com/gobuffalo/logger \
-		gobuffalo:mapi:v1.0.1:mapi/src/github.com/gobuffalo/mapi \
-		gobuffalo:meta:50bbb1f:meta/src/github.com/gobuffalo/meta \
-		gobuffalo:packd:eca3b8f:packd/src/github.com/gobuffalo/packd \
-		gobuffalo:syncx:558ac7d:syncx/src/github.com/gobuffalo/syncx \
-		golang:crypto:ff983b9:crypto/src/golang.org/x/crypto \
-		golang:sync:37e7f08:sync/src/golang.org/x/sync \
-		golang:sys:11f53e0:sys/src/golang.org/x/sys \
-		golang:tools:16909d2:tools/src/golang.org/x/tools \
-		inconshreveable:mousetrap:v1.0.0:mousetrap/src/github.com/inconshreveable/mousetrap \
-		joho:godotenv:v1.3.0:godotenv/src/github.com/joho/godotenv \
-		karrick:godirwalk:v1.7.8:godirwalk/src/github.com/karrick/godirwalk \
-		markbates:oncer:bf2de49:oncer/src/github.com/markbates/oncer \
-		markbates:safe:v1.0.1:safe/src/github.com/markbates/safe \
-		pkg:errors:v0.8.1:pkg/src/github.com/pkg/errors \
-		rogpeppe:go-internal:v1.1.0:go_internal/src/github.com/rogpeppe/go-internal \
-		sirupsen:logrus:v1.3.0:logrus/src/github.com/sirupsen/logrus \
-		spf13:cobra:v0.0.3:cobra/src/github.com/spf13/cobra \
-		spf13:pflag:v1.0.3:pflag/src/github.com/spf13/pflag
+		BurntSushi:toml:v0.3.1:burntsushi_toml/vendor/github.com/BurntSushi/toml \
+		gobuffalo:buffalo-plugins:v1.12.0:gobuffalo_buffalo_plugins/vendor/github.com/gobuffalo/buffalo-plugins \
+		gobuffalo:envy:v1.6.15:gobuffalo_envy/vendor/github.com/gobuffalo/envy \
+		gobuffalo:events:v1.2.0:gobuffalo_events/vendor/github.com/gobuffalo/events \
+		gobuffalo:flect:v0.1.0:gobuffalo_flect/vendor/github.com/gobuffalo/flect \
+		gobuffalo:genny:c950828:gobuffalo_genny/vendor/github.com/gobuffalo/genny \
+		gobuffalo:gogen:1c60761:gobuffalo_gogen/vendor/github.com/gobuffalo/gogen \
+		gobuffalo:logger:be78ebf:gobuffalo_logger/vendor/github.com/gobuffalo/logger \
+		gobuffalo:mapi:v1.0.1:gobuffalo_mapi/vendor/github.com/gobuffalo/mapi \
+		gobuffalo:meta:ecaa953:gobuffalo_meta/vendor/github.com/gobuffalo/meta \
+		gobuffalo:packd:d04dd98:gobuffalo_packd/vendor/github.com/gobuffalo/packd \
+		gobuffalo:syncx:558ac7d:gobuffalo_syncx/vendor/github.com/gobuffalo/syncx \
+		golang:crypto:74369b4:golang_crypto/vendor/golang.org/x/crypto \
+		golang:sync:37e7f08:golang_sync/vendor/golang.org/x/sync \
+		golang:sys:11f53e0:golang_sys/vendor/golang.org/x/sys \
+		golang:tools:83362c3:golang_tools/vendor/golang.org/x/tools \
+		inconshreveable:mousetrap:v1.0.0:inconshreveable_mousetrap/vendor/github.com/inconshreveable/mousetrap \
+		joho:godotenv:v1.3.0:joho_godotenv/vendor/github.com/joho/godotenv \
+		karrick:godirwalk:v1.7.8:karrick_godirwalk/vendor/github.com/karrick/godirwalk \
+		konsorten:go-windows-terminal-sequences:v1.0.1:konsorten_go_windows_terminal_sequences/vendor/github.com/konsorten/go-windows-terminal-sequences \
+		markbates:oncer:bf2de49:markbates_oncer/vendor/github.com/markbates/oncer \
+		markbates:safe:v1.0.1:markbates_safe/vendor/github.com/markbates/safe \
+		pkg:errors:v0.8.1:pkg_errors/vendor/github.com/pkg/errors \
+		rogpeppe:go-internal:v1.2.2:rogpeppe_go_internal/vendor/github.com/rogpeppe/go-internal \
+		sirupsen:logrus:v1.3.0:sirupsen_logrus/vendor/github.com/sirupsen/logrus \
+		spf13:cobra:v0.0.3:spf13_cobra/vendor/github.com/spf13/cobra \
+		spf13:pflag:v1.0.3:spf13_pflag/vendor/github.com/spf13/pflag
 
-PLIST_FILES=	bin/packr
+PLIST_FILES=	bin/packr \
+		bin/packr2
 
 PORTDOCS=	README.md
 
 OPTIONS_DEFINE=	DOCS
-
-do-build:
-	cd ${WRKSRC}/${GH_SUBDIR}/packr && ${SETENV} ${MAKE_ENV} GOPATH=${WRKSRC} go build
-
-do-install:
-	${INSTALL_PROGRAM} ${WRKSRC}/${GH_SUBDIR}/packr/packr ${STAGEDIR}${PREFIX}/bin
 
 post-install-DOCS-on:
 	@${MKDIR} ${STAGEDIR}${DOCSDIR}

Modified: head/devel/packr/distinfo
==============================================================================
--- head/devel/packr/distinfo	Tue Feb 26 23:51:17 2019	(r494002)
+++ head/devel/packr/distinfo	Wed Feb 27 00:42:47 2019	(r494003)
@@ -1,50 +1,54 @@
-TIMESTAMP = 1549869514
-SHA256 (gobuffalo-packr-v2.0.1_GH0.tar.gz) = cc0488e99faeda4cf56631666175335e1cce021746972ce84b8a3083aa88622f
-SIZE (gobuffalo-packr-v2.0.1_GH0.tar.gz) = 100277
+TIMESTAMP = 1551187103
+SHA256 (gobuffalo-packr-v2.0.2_GH0.tar.gz) = b2c4193b10b22c4ae4886edbb172c87ab94165e91de221d90994d0ff8bdb006d
+SIZE (gobuffalo-packr-v2.0.2_GH0.tar.gz) = 105460
 SHA256 (BurntSushi-toml-v0.3.1_GH0.tar.gz) = 6593da894578ba510a470735ffbdc88ce88033094dc5a8f4d3957ab87e18803f
 SIZE (BurntSushi-toml-v0.3.1_GH0.tar.gz) = 42077
-SHA256 (gobuffalo-buffalo-plugins-v1.11.0_GH0.tar.gz) = d3ec736fb8f4b7ca6c4c48e390c9724a92ba14349e1e315a758aa729436f4bc4
-SIZE (gobuffalo-buffalo-plugins-v1.11.0_GH0.tar.gz) = 118044
-SHA256 (gobuffalo-envy-v1.6.12_GH0.tar.gz) = 56151615b5efbbc9ff1f6f1aa04d9220b44c733763e45543757827e706360710
-SIZE (gobuffalo-envy-v1.6.12_GH0.tar.gz) = 20992
-SHA256 (gobuffalo-events-v1.1.9_GH0.tar.gz) = d0f1d3319ab24f7c2f172791f226d5cc59e00c8d754d3fd1f0cfee1618fbf618
-SIZE (gobuffalo-events-v1.1.9_GH0.tar.gz) = 23228
-SHA256 (gobuffalo-flect-a62e61d_GH0.tar.gz) = 281ccd6e1740c58576e347211453cc66eaad9f36b6aff49f52b9ece19964930d
-SIZE (gobuffalo-flect-a62e61d_GH0.tar.gz) = 28885
-SHA256 (gobuffalo-genny-f31a84f_GH0.tar.gz) = cef458b87f99a0a8c640cd2d96a507220c65fac9351bffd81119cb9b70aa1fe3
-SIZE (gobuffalo-genny-f31a84f_GH0.tar.gz) = 52728
-SHA256 (gobuffalo-logger-5b956e2_GH0.tar.gz) = fa9a54926f65974fa9f8b953f9f42934bba9bc1bb2ed59ce19ad08481da1faae
-SIZE (gobuffalo-logger-5b956e2_GH0.tar.gz) = 5989
+SHA256 (gobuffalo-buffalo-plugins-v1.12.0_GH0.tar.gz) = 531808e8f66e40657a7912f53d5f24f0ccbd1a66c026e05491200736c616c7fd
+SIZE (gobuffalo-buffalo-plugins-v1.12.0_GH0.tar.gz) = 119795
+SHA256 (gobuffalo-envy-v1.6.15_GH0.tar.gz) = 6826e41c3e694b737a145c6c95397a337081b9d3f0ef4e377d4705fd158960c1
+SIZE (gobuffalo-envy-v1.6.15_GH0.tar.gz) = 6995
+SHA256 (gobuffalo-events-v1.2.0_GH0.tar.gz) = 052eefa2c12da3166ffb635804fc00974209151e2482b74c9418e3d0e24a6a84
+SIZE (gobuffalo-events-v1.2.0_GH0.tar.gz) = 23974
+SHA256 (gobuffalo-flect-v0.1.0_GH0.tar.gz) = 6ed33d59fe003abfc8a3e31b5b1df8b0a1735d851c41b07c0a53e1688cdc25a9
+SIZE (gobuffalo-flect-v0.1.0_GH0.tar.gz) = 16193
+SHA256 (gobuffalo-genny-c950828_GH0.tar.gz) = ad7eeff4a617ea316d1dcefb5173aa60d2bf95354700d71100e8ce7c2ab78f7f
+SIZE (gobuffalo-genny-c950828_GH0.tar.gz) = 51281
+SHA256 (gobuffalo-gogen-1c60761_GH0.tar.gz) = 92efef855bb76dabad48c15920311971c482ea3edb0aff3402c1dd688a8ec6db
+SIZE (gobuffalo-gogen-1c60761_GH0.tar.gz) = 32041
+SHA256 (gobuffalo-logger-be78ebf_GH0.tar.gz) = bf56eb12631bbcb05b1c13d7eb4c058b408de67d38e71b549099ae51636391b1
+SIZE (gobuffalo-logger-be78ebf_GH0.tar.gz) = 6336
 SHA256 (gobuffalo-mapi-v1.0.1_GH0.tar.gz) = 56abd81b46098223236734106e9756706ffc15e064c1c0f6675edd9505e4be20
 SIZE (gobuffalo-mapi-v1.0.1_GH0.tar.gz) = 3651
-SHA256 (gobuffalo-meta-50bbb1f_GH0.tar.gz) = 37d0177bcdde0a4b690be5acc713127b0846044a4c76809d5f30245ca896a083
-SIZE (gobuffalo-meta-50bbb1f_GH0.tar.gz) = 20648
-SHA256 (gobuffalo-packd-eca3b8f_GH0.tar.gz) = 4c014fb075a37c24480d6fd6de73d34f1a4539e2fa1515d518a8d9d2b09195e4
-SIZE (gobuffalo-packd-eca3b8f_GH0.tar.gz) = 7190
+SHA256 (gobuffalo-meta-ecaa953_GH0.tar.gz) = 136096e7fc7f2d87f02448804c1e367c173bb0b1a92fdcccde07929a569f506f
+SIZE (gobuffalo-meta-ecaa953_GH0.tar.gz) = 20733
+SHA256 (gobuffalo-packd-d04dd98_GH0.tar.gz) = a69644351ff12dfe7de301e94da508b28fc6e396c66699e061ef4079e6237fa0
+SIZE (gobuffalo-packd-d04dd98_GH0.tar.gz) = 7515
 SHA256 (gobuffalo-syncx-558ac7d_GH0.tar.gz) = 5c06155b0eb5b1b4d01d42d2fdf508da27cc94a35bd3e0e134a3c172cc8cffe6
 SIZE (gobuffalo-syncx-558ac7d_GH0.tar.gz) = 4078
-SHA256 (golang-crypto-ff983b9_GH0.tar.gz) = d2010506ef18ad13d7a32f3bf0164448f71a25cecaa31de6891f4aa699201061
-SIZE (golang-crypto-ff983b9_GH0.tar.gz) = 1644717
+SHA256 (golang-crypto-74369b4_GH0.tar.gz) = 38464f4fbc2d24dedac2987e921b72cbbb27bf3fc00d2587159b528bdb921392
+SIZE (golang-crypto-74369b4_GH0.tar.gz) = 1647884
 SHA256 (golang-sync-37e7f08_GH0.tar.gz) = 98656550e30c38e866788484978105ae6b0aa15fcfdecb7735e3c2cf392e8a92
 SIZE (golang-sync-37e7f08_GH0.tar.gz) = 16233
 SHA256 (golang-sys-11f53e0_GH0.tar.gz) = d2df8aa766815df407e570e1974241d5b44fcb44733052734863cf539c7368a0
 SIZE (golang-sys-11f53e0_GH0.tar.gz) = 1220001
-SHA256 (golang-tools-16909d2_GH0.tar.gz) = 2c0750fcfb3ae959d75a7eeb10b66d7f94f79ca4276a469f942e47003b15226a
-SIZE (golang-tools-16909d2_GH0.tar.gz) = 2829284
+SHA256 (golang-tools-83362c3_GH0.tar.gz) = 917da645548756a8aad5829efc3b422035693ebf6a0cff070a3b0c539f3bee91
+SIZE (golang-tools-83362c3_GH0.tar.gz) = 2643231
 SHA256 (inconshreveable-mousetrap-v1.0.0_GH0.tar.gz) = 5edc7731c819c305623568e317aa253d342be3447def97f1fa9e10eb5ad819f6
 SIZE (inconshreveable-mousetrap-v1.0.0_GH0.tar.gz) = 2290
 SHA256 (joho-godotenv-v1.3.0_GH0.tar.gz) = 07beb0bae964dbe37442603a404196111dbbbaaa986fc179d5d5fdc46ed6a189
 SIZE (joho-godotenv-v1.3.0_GH0.tar.gz) = 9941
 SHA256 (karrick-godirwalk-v1.7.8_GH0.tar.gz) = 0f5a5963ba210bf00685177963b1a792c698de194b0f5993a8669d488ef78d8b
 SIZE (karrick-godirwalk-v1.7.8_GH0.tar.gz) = 15158
+SHA256 (konsorten-go-windows-terminal-sequences-v1.0.1_GH0.tar.gz) = e36c5a5de388bf72db3037b47f025b09e574be8d0bc74b3e44c960cba0880e87
+SIZE (konsorten-go-windows-terminal-sequences-v1.0.1_GH0.tar.gz) = 1909
 SHA256 (markbates-oncer-bf2de49_GH0.tar.gz) = 9fd5db2f645e68c2551808acb6161c692e529a1d7ff70d0473796260ef409bba
 SIZE (markbates-oncer-bf2de49_GH0.tar.gz) = 2772
 SHA256 (markbates-safe-v1.0.1_GH0.tar.gz) = 8356d63a2175445960eecc237cf82fc206d328d48c03e4564546d9158af62142
 SIZE (markbates-safe-v1.0.1_GH0.tar.gz) = 2888
 SHA256 (pkg-errors-v0.8.1_GH0.tar.gz) = 7a428967c6fc2e80cd84a0d9469ab6bd4dbe6b13493ba6294322a933a5a7e356
 SIZE (pkg-errors-v0.8.1_GH0.tar.gz) = 11009
-SHA256 (rogpeppe-go-internal-v1.1.0_GH0.tar.gz) = 62dc0ef0a1df7d0c06cb7bf8dc50d92facea89d7d3558883800c9bd341aaca9f
-SIZE (rogpeppe-go-internal-v1.1.0_GH0.tar.gz) = 106099
+SHA256 (rogpeppe-go-internal-v1.2.2_GH0.tar.gz) = 4f9749912f955c8c6cf741bb2b2773fd9bf7ca19512821f29a538cad20f8a586
+SIZE (rogpeppe-go-internal-v1.2.2_GH0.tar.gz) = 110764
 SHA256 (sirupsen-logrus-v1.3.0_GH0.tar.gz) = f80cfa34148c4e25c4d3030edb1fd9878d666eca7e900f1aaf0d87c67ecabe51
 SIZE (sirupsen-logrus-v1.3.0_GH0.tar.gz) = 38452
 SHA256 (spf13-cobra-v0.0.3_GH0.tar.gz) = 7eafb953b58fdd738c4db5202d94a0b6ac0de4f07718fc85a80450c2347c2f9c


More information about the svn-ports-head mailing list